Associate Manager, Operations - Montréal, Canada - SSENSE
Description
Company DescriptionSSENSE (pronounced [es-uhns]) is a global technology platform operating at the intersection of culture, community, and commerce.
Headquartered in Montreal, it features a mix of established and emerging luxury brands across womenswear, menswear, kidswear, and Everything Else.
SSENSE has garnered critical acclaim as both an e-commerce engine and a producer of cultural content, generating an average of 100 million monthly page views.
Job Description:
Reporting to the Manager, Operations, the Associate Manager is responsible for overseeing the daily operations of their area through staff supervision and workflow organisation.
They will work closely with the team to report area metrics, fulfil SLA's requirements, and drive continuous improvement in operational processes.
The Associate Manager will have complete functional process responsibility within the distribution center on a specified shift.Responsibilities
